Details about this class

This is a fully online asynchronous course with no scheduled live meetings. Students will complete weekly modules through D2L Brightspace. Course materials, assignment instructions, lectures, announcements, due dates, and feedback will be posted in D2L.

Students are expected to log in regularly throughout the week, review announcements, complete weekly assignments by the posted deadlines, and contact the instructor early if they have questions or need help. First-week participation is required and may include completing an introduction activity or another required course activity.

This course introduces students to data analytics concepts and tools, including data preparation, structured and unstructured data, data mining, predictive analytics, OLAP concepts, data visualization, dashboards, and reporting. Students will gain hands-on experience cleaning, analyzing, visualizing, and presenting data for decision-making.

Technology

Students will need access to a reliable computer, stable internet connection, D2L Brightspace, and a supported web browser. Students should also have access to spreadsheet software such as Microsoft Excel or Google Sheets. Additional free or commonly available data analytics tools may be used during the course, such as SQL/database tools, Tableau Public, Google Looker Studio, Python, or similar tools. Setup instructions will be provided in D2L Brightspace.
